tui-disasm: Fix window content buffer overrun
A user reported a GDB crash with TUI when trying to debug a function with a long demangled C++ method name. It turned out that the logic for displaying the TUI disassembly window has a bug that can cause a buffer overrun, possibly overwriting GDB-internal data structures. In particular, the logic performs an unguarded strcpy. Another (harmless) bug in tui_alloc_source_buffer causes the buffer to be two lines longer than needed. This may have made the crash appear less frequently. gdb/ChangeLog: * tui/tui-disasm.c (tui_set_disassem_content): Fix line buffer overrun due to unchecked strcpy. gdb/testsuite/ChangeLog: * gdb.base/tui-layout.c: New file. * gdb.base/tui-layout.exp: Use tui-layout.c, to ensure that the disassembly window contains very long lines.
